What you’ll need to succeed as a Diesel Mechanic at XPO

Minimum qualifications:

  • 2 years of experience in tractor and trailer inspection and repair, a technical school degree with certification in heavy-duty truck/trailer maintenance
  • Obtain EPA HVAC Refrigerant Recovery and Recycling Certification within 90 days of hire (ASE, MACS or equivalent)
  • A valid driver’s license
  • Basic welding skills (Oxy/Acetylene, MIG and ARC) and mechanical skills
  • Basic hand tools required for heavy-duty trailer and tractor maintenance
  • Basic computer skills
  • Brake inspection qualified as defined in the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ration regulations, Section 396.25
  • Vehicle Inspection qualified as defined in the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ration regulations, Section 396.19
  • Available to work a variety of shifts, including days, evenings, nights, and weekends

 

Preferred q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ent work-related or military experience
  • Prior mechanical experience such as automotive or skilled trades
  • Previous or current ASE certifications
  • Diesel tech school diploma
  • Experience with trailer repair, diesel engine system diagnostics and preventive maintenance for tractor technicians
  • Able to diagnose and repair vehicle air conditioning systems

What you’ll do on a typical day:

  • Perform routine maintenance functions and adjustments on all types of class 6 through 8 diesel equipment, forklifts, and trailing equipment
  • Access any of the equipment to perform necessary maintenance, including inspecting and performing work in, on or under part of the equipment
  • Repair or rebuild all or parts of various equipment systems
  • Troubleshoot and diagnose equipment and component issues and perform repairs accordingly
  • Perform HVAC system repairs
  • Abide by DOT, EPA, Interstate Authority, OSHA and other rules and regulations
  • Conduct safety inspections on equipment and prepare safety documentation as needed
  • Maintain proficiency with equipment and technologies that enhance productivity
  • Move trailers throughout the property, operating a hostler in all types of weather
  • Enter job times and parts on repair orders to track activity
  • Operate specialized tooling and vehicles
  • Ensure the work area is always clean, safe, and organized
  • Interact with operations and shop management

 

Diesel Mechanics are required to:

  • Frequently lift up to 50 lbs. and occasionally lift more than 75 lbs.
  • Safely walk and stand for extended periods on various surfaces that may be uneven or slippery, including working outdoors in inclement weather
  • Reach (including above your head), bend, climb, push, pull, twist, squat and kneel
  • Walk and stand for extended periods on a loading dock that is not climate-controlled and may be slippery
